📄 Abstract(原文)

ABSTRACT:   Energy plays the most vital role in the economic growth, progress, and development, as well as poverty eradication and security of any nation. Uninterrupted power supply is a vital issue for many countries today. Future economic growth crucially depends on the long-term availability of energy from sources that are affordable, accessible, and environmentally friendly. Hydroelectric Power is a form of renewable energy source that has being in existence for quite a long time in advanced countries. Other renewable resources include geothermal, wave power, tidal power, wind power, and solar power. The aim of this paper is to study Arinta Water-falls as an initiative for harnessing electric power from mini-hydro production. It is established that the obtainable head and flow rate available during the selected months of the raining season at Arinta water falls should be sustainable for mini-hydro power plant. The effect on the ecosystem is very less, the ecotourism will attract visitors and the living standard of the people in the area will improve after commissioning of a mini-hydroelectric power station. Hence, the problem of in- adequate electric power production would be improved by using sustainable technology. KEYWORDS: Mini-hydroelectric, Energy, flow rate, Arinta Water fall, Ekiti, Nigeria
